Multinational companies generate budget forecasts, P&L statements, and expense tracking sheets in one language but need them in others for regional offices. Translating these files manually risks formula errors that corrupt financial calculations.
The tool allows finance teams to translate excel file to english or any other language while preserving sum totals, percentage calculations, and currency conversion formulas. Quarterly reports sent to international stakeholders maintain computational accuracy and professional appearance without requiring a financial analyst to rebuild the spreadsheet in each language.
E-commerce businesses maintain massive inventory lists with thousands of SKUs, product descriptions, and pricing tiers. When expanding to new markets, these catalogs must be converted so local teams can understand stock levels and specifications.
Automatic translation excel processing handles large product databases efficiently. A 10,000-row inventory file with columns for item names, descriptions, and categories gets translated while numeric SKUs and price values remain unchanged. This enables rapid market entry without manual data re-entry or the risk of mismatched product codes between regional systems.
Academic researchers and clinical trial coordinators collect survey responses, lab measurements, and statistical datasets in Excel format. International collaboration requires these datasets to have translated column headers and category labels while raw numeric data remains unchanged for analysis.
The translate excel sheet to english function (or into Arabic, Chinese, etc.) converts metadata and descriptive text while leaving numeric measurements untouched. Statistical software like SPSS or R can import the translated file directly because the data structure remains valid. Collaboration across institutions becomes seamless even when team members speak different languages.
